Headset On/Off
The Headset On/Off feature allows headset usage to be activated or deactivated
using a Line/Feature button. When this feature is active, the green indicator light
corresponding to the button administered signifies the headset is off-hook; when
the indicator is not lit, it signifies on-hook headset status.
Inspect
The Inspect feature provides call-related information for an incoming or held call
when you are active on another call.
Using the Inspect feature
1. Press
Menu
, use the Arrow display control buttons to scroll through the
options until you see
Inspt;
then press the softkey below
Inspt
,
or
If
Inspt
is not available on the display, press the Line/Feature button your
System Administrator has programmed to represent this feature.
2. Press the Line/Feature button of the incoming or held call.
The display shows the name and/or number of the person calling/on hold,
and you remain connected to the active call.
3. To answer the incoming or held call, put the current call on hold (or hang
up).
4. Press the Line/Feature button of the incoming or held call.
